Home foundation services involve assessing, repairing, and stabilizing the structural base of a property to ensure its safety and stability. These services typically include inspections to identify issues such as cracks, uneven flooring, or visible shifts in the foundation. Once problems are diagnosed, contractors can perform repairs like underpinning, slab lifting, or wall stabilization to restore the foundation’s integrity. Proper foundation work is essential for maintaining the overall safety of a home and preventing further structural damage over time.
Many common problems indicate a need for foundation services. These include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and uneven or sloping flooring. Signs of foundation issues often become more apparent after extreme weather events, such as heavy rain or drought, which can cause shifting or settling. Addressing these concerns early with professional foundation services can help prevent more serious problems, such as structural failure or cost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chesterfield,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s, such as crack filling or small patching,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the scale.
Foundation Leveling - More extensive leveling services, which involve adjusting and stabilizing the foundation,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ects can sometimes exceed this range, depending on the extent of work needed.
Full Foundation Replacement - Replacing an entire foundation can cost from $10,000 to $30,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. These larger projects are less common but are necessary for severely damaged or unstable foundations.
Basement Waterproofing - Waterproofing services typically range from $2,000 to $8,000, with many projects falling into the middle of this spectrum. Larger or more comprehensive waterproofing systems can push costs higher, especially for extensive basement are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s can include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ation or trim.
How do local contractors typically assess foundation problems? They perform visual inspections, look for structural shifts, and may use specialized tools to evaluate the stability and integrity of the foundation.
What types of foundation repair services are available in Chesterfield, MO? Services may include piering, underpinning, slab stabilization, and crack repair, depending on the specific foundation condition.
